Gabor Ezzel a dátummal: Friday 28 March 2008 00:25:44 Sam Varshavchik ezt írta: > As I said above, set it up just like any other, ordinary, mail account. > Call it '[EMAIL PROTECTED]', or, better yet, call this account "Public". > Create its home directory, and its Maildir. Add it to the shared/index > file, exactly like you've added the existing two accounts. > > Set up an admin login and password, for this account, in courier-authlib. > Use the userdb module, which is very convenient for this use, or your > existing module. Log in to this account, via an ACL-capable IMAP client. > Set the ACLs on the account's INBOX accordingly. Create a "Notices", or any > other folder in the mailbox, and set its ACLs too. > > If you do not have an ACL-capable IMAP client, use the maildiracl command, > making sure that you run it using your virtual uid and gid. > > Test that you can see the public account by using telnet to port 143, then: > > A login [EMAIL PROTECTED] [password] > > A list "" "#shared.*" > ------------------------------------------------------------------------- Check out the new SourceForge.net Marketplace.
